Due to being out of tree, ZFS is ironically the only FS out there except [ex]FAT[0-9]{2} that is truly OS-independent. OpenZFS was taken from IllumOS/Solaris but it also works perfectly on Linux and FreeBSD (sharing the same codebase actually). The filesystem also has been very usable on macOS for a long time and there's even a WIP port for Windows that works surprisingly well.
